agent: retire eager KB priority/planner path and its dead flags
The pull-based KB design (on-demand search_knowledge_base tool + pre-injected workspace tree) fully replaced the old eager retrieval path. Remove its last remnants: - Delete KnowledgePriorityMiddleware (knowledge_search.py) and its tests. - Drop the kb_priority state field + reducer default; trim KbContextProjectionMiddleware to project only workspace_tree_text. - Remove the now-dead feature flags enable_kb_priority_preinjection and enable_kb_planner_runnable across backend (flags, route schema, tests, env examples) and frontend (settings toggle, zod schema). - Scrub <priority_documents> and stale KnowledgePriorityMiddleware references from prompts, docstrings, and the ADR. No functional change: nothing wrote kb_priority and neither flag gated live behavior after the cutover. Full backend suite green (pre-existing unrelated failures aside).
